Protecting your crew is a necessary legal requirement that needs thorough care and attention in order for you to focus your attention on more important matters. The correct yacht crew insurance will brighten everyones mood onboard, knowing that they are protected from the unexpected. A typical example might be this:
A U.S. worker (who spends over six-months at home) onboard a yacht who travels out of U.S. territory occasionally whilst on working duty.
The recommended protection in this case would be to consult a health insurance expert and discuss terms for a state-controlled insurance policy that covers the party whilst abroad. Careful planning for your yacht crew insurance, such as this, will ensure that you are not taking out the wrong policies and that inidividual needs of your crew are considered.
It is recommended that a health insurance expert who specializes in the insurance of yacht crew’s is consulted prior to entering agreement terms with your team. They can often extract the needs of each member and negotiate the correct policy. Such insurance will be essential in reducing the risk of lawful cases filed against you and/or your company should any unfortunate event occurs. Signed contracts overseen by a solicitor will help both parties feel secure in their negotiations. Typical coverage will cover anything from $50,000 to $1 million and are ideally suited for expatriates, missionaries, executives and marine crew who live abroad.
